Watering Practices

Consistent watering is essential during flowering. Cucumbers need approximately 1 to 2 inches of water per week. Water deeply at the base of the plant to encourage strong root growth and prevent water stress, which can lead to blossom drop.

Tips for Effective Watering

  • Water early in the morning to reduce evaporation.
  • Avoid overhead watering to prevent fungal diseases.
  • Use mulch around the plants to retain soil moisture.

Fertilization for Optimal Growth

Proper fertilization supports flowering and fruit development. Use a balanced fertilizer high in phosphorus and potassium, such as a 10-20-10 blend, to promote healthy blossoms and fruit set.

Fertilizer Application Tips

  • Apply fertilizer at the base of the plant every 2-3 weeks.
  • Avoid over-fertilizing, which can lead to excessive foliage growth at the expense of flowers.
  • Consider using compost tea for a natural nutrient boost.

Supporting Flowering and Fruit Development

Supporting your cucumber plants during flowering helps increase pollination and fruit set. Providing a pollinator-friendly environment and managing pests are key components of successful cultivation.

Pollination Tips

  • Plant flowering cucumbers in areas accessible to bees and other pollinators.
  • Manually pollinate flowers with a small brush if natural pollination is limited.
  • Avoid using pesticides during flowering that can harm pollinators.

Pest and Disease Management

Monitoring for pests and diseases during flowering is essential to prevent damage and ensure healthy fruit development. Common issues include aphids, powdery mildew, and cucumber beetles.

Preventive Measures

  • Inspect plants regularly for signs of pests or disease.
  • Use organic insecticides or natural predators to control pests.
  • Maintain good air circulation around plants to reduce fungal infections.
